The loudspeaker crossover presents an ideal opportunity
to neutralize both the on-axis and o-axis response of
the system. Engineers are inherently limited to how many
corrections they can make by building passive crossovers
with large components. By moving the crossover out of the
speaker and in front of the amplier and also into the digital
domain, we gain virtually unlimited ability to linearize system
performance.
Traditional crossovers are also lossy. No matter how
well designed, they absorb and reect energy meant for the drivers. An active loudspeaker is placed before the ampliers, so the amps are directly coupled to the drivers for best performance.

Compared to our passive loudspeakers
Bryston’s Active Loudspeakers come even closer to
the ideal power response without sacrices to on-axis
response. Power response is the weighted measure of
a loudspeaker’s total energy. It is not sucient to simply design for at on-axis response. By ensuring
that power response tracks the more
narrowly dened listening window closely, we can ensure that the room’s contribution to the nal sound is benecial, not destructive.

Bryston evaluates response based on
two measurements which are much more indicative of real performance compared
to basic on-axis tests. Our listening window response measurement includes an on-axis frequency response plot but also a series of measurements taken from a +/- 15 degree
window in front of the loudspeaker. This gives you a true indication of how the loudspeaker sounds when you’re seated at many realistic positions in front of it.
We also measure sound power which is a weighted average

Power Up
ince Bryston Active Loudspeakers have no internal
S
passive crossover components, each driver is directly
coupled to an amplier channel so the ampliers can exert remarkable control over even the smallest movements of
the loudspeaker elements.
Each Bryston Active Loudspeaker is a three-way model, so a total of 6 amplier channels are required. We have developed two amplier models with channels cleverly arranged to support the dynamic range requirements between low, midrange and high frequency drivers.
The 24B Cubed is a 6 channel unit featuring two 300 watt channels for the bass sections and four 75 watt channels for midrange and high frequencies. Such a model is ideal for

Choose a pair of 21B Cubed ampliers for more ambitious playback volume and/or larger rooms. Each of the ‘three channel monoblocks’ includes a single 600 watt channel for the bass section plus two 300 watt channels for the midrange and high frequency drivers.
Naturally, the loudspeakers may also be powered by
arranging your own selection of mono, two channel and
multi-channel Bryston ampliers. Choose any six channels from our broad range of models and enjoy tremendous exibility as further upgrades are desired.

Get Connected
pgrading to a Bryston Active system is easier than you
U
might expect. Our system allows you to use whichever preamplier and source components you desire. Simply connect your preamp’s outputs to the inputs of the BAX-1
crossover. For the each of the left and right speakers, the
BAX-1 creates three signals—Low, Mid, and High. These signals are then passed on to the appropriate amplier
channels.
The BAX-1 permanently operates at 96kHz / 24 bit resolution maximizing the transparency of the expertly engineered
converters. Even analog source components are rendered with startling realism and naturalness.
Once you have carefully placed the loudspeakers at
their optimum positions in the room, through acoustic
measurement or by ear, you may elect to equalize the bass
response to overcome tonal response irregularities due to
the room. From the sweet spot, use a tablet, mobile phone or laptop to adjust the bass response with our web-based user
interface.
